Prep Report: Sego breaks Triton Central's career scoring record

Class 2A, No. 7 Triton Central earned no worse than a share of the Hoosier Legends Conference title and senior Eli Sego became the program’s career scoring leader Friday in a 57-45 win over Beech Grove.

The win improved the Tigers to 18-3 (4-0 HLC) and can secure the conference title outright Friday against Speedway (11-9, 2-2). Tri-West (13-8, 4-1) will need the Sparkplugs to secure a road victory to share the title with Triton Central.

Sego entered the game needing 20 points to surpass Wyatt Felling’s career record of 1,553 points. With a fourth-quarter steal and breakaway layin at the rim, Sego took the record. He added six more free throws in the quarter to finish with a game-high 27 points.

 

 

Sego is now the eighth-leading scorer in Shelby County history and needs just 10 points to pass Morristown’s Logan Laster for No. 7.

The Tigers led 22-15 over Beech Grove at halftime then extended the lead to 41-29 after three quarters.

Brody Hartman and Brayden Hoover each scored seven points. Conner McClure had five.

A.J. Amos and Flavius Tyler each finished with 12 points to lead the Hornets (8-14, 2-3).

Morristown 59, Muncie Burris 38

At Morristown, the Yellow Jackets built a 14-11 lead after one quarter then outscored the Owls 34-20 over the next two quarters to secure a fifth-straight win.

Four different Morristown players scored in double digits, led by Kellen Crim’s 14 points. Brody Smith and Dalton McMichael each had 12 and Owen Rinzel finished with 10.

Crim also had seven assists and two steals. Smith had a team-high 10 rebounds.

Matthew Price led the Owls (8-12) with 10 points.

Morristown (16-5), with its most regular season wins since 2021, closes out the regular season schedule Friday against Anderson Prep (8-12).

Waldron 59, Victory College Prep 47

At Victory College Prep, the Mohawks held a 13-point lead after three quarters then hit 9 of 12 free throws in the fourth to seal their fifth-straight win.

Caige Sheaffer led Waldron (14-7) with 18 points and six rebounds. Ethan Moody finished with 16 points and six rebounds while Eli Stewart totaled 14 points, seven rebounds and four assists.

Rico White hit four three-pointers and led the Bulldogs (3-14) with 21 points.

Waldron closes the regular season Friday at Rising Sun (7-15).

North Decatur 58, Southwestern 21

At North Decatur Friday, the Chargers completely shut down the Southwestern offense and cruised to the Mid-Hoosier Conference victory.

Wyatt Reisman topped North Decatur (11-12, 4-2 MHC) with 12 points. Garrett Schwering had 11 points and Matthew Fields finished with 10.

The Chargers led 16-6 after one quarter and 33-12 at halftime.

Cecil Newton led the Spartans with eight points.

North Decatur won the junior varsity game, 52-49. Leland Riddle led the Southwestern with 14 points.                

Southwestern 79, Columbus Christian 48

At Southwestern Saturday, the Spartans rebounded from their MHC loss one night earlier to score at least 20 points in three of the four quarters to defeat the Crusaders.

Jay Utley led Southwestern (5-14) with 21 points. Dusty Stevens had 17. Newton finished with 14 and Landon Drake added 10.

Ben Cater led Columbus Christian (8-16) with 12 points.

The Spartans won the JV game, 55-49. Chandler Holt had 19 points to lead Southwestern. Gavin Harrison added 13.

Southwestern’s regular-season schedule ends Thursday at Anderson Prep (8-12).
